Subject: Re: [PATCH v7 03/17] CXL/PCI: Introduce PCIe helper functions
 pcie_is_cxl() and pcie_is_cxl_port()

On Tue, Feb 11, 2025 at 01:24:30PM -0600, Terry Bowman wrote:
> CXL and AER drivers need the ability to identify CXL devices and CXL port
> devices.
> 
> First, add set_pcie_cxl() with logic checking for CXL Flexbus DVSEC
> presence. The CXL Flexbus DVSEC presence is used because it is required
> for all the CXL PCIe devices.[1]
> 
> Add boolean 'struct pci_dev::is_cxl' with the purpose to cache the CXL
> Flexbus presence.
> 
> Add pcie_is_cxl() as a macro to return 'struct pci_dev::is_cxl'.
> 
> Add pcie_is_cxl_port() to check if a device is a CXL Root Port, CXL
> Upstream Switch Port, or CXL Downstream Switch Port. Also, verify the
> CXL Extensions DVSEC for Ports is present.[1]
> 
> [1] CXL 3.1 Spec, 8.1.1 PCIe Designated Vendor-Specific Extended
>     Capability (DVSEC) ID Assignment, Table 8-2
> 
> Signed-off-by: Terry Bowman <terry.bowman@....com>
> Reviewed-by: Jonathan Cameron <Jonathan.Cameron@...wei.com>
> Reviewed-by: Dave Jiang <dave.jiang@...el.com>
> Reviewed-by: Fan Ni <fan.ni@...sung.com>

Acked-by: Bjorn Helgaas <bhelgaas@...gle.com>

But I would change the subject to:

  PCI/CXL: ...

since this only changes drivers/pci files.
